Output ebf8a90ee21c06c8457314c0b336e65355e9d2b5bee11960f4599f0ca1edfe47:5

value
3721027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3759ebd9cd68bbcf2122c26fc178a27106597 OP_EQUAL
address
3BMEXYajfXoFARKg19Vt2PbN6uxLaPMF8q
transaction
ebf8a90ee21c06c8457314c0b336e65355e9d2b5bee11960f4599f0ca1edfe47
spent
true